Output ed3ddda223ea8db186b110ce724c3112489b74cf13f394048418f4c182eeb83a:1

value
261707880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e10fe970460937b797ebe6f20f3c7a0339fd795 OP_EQUAL
address
3EeCEagytLLJJk3AwseFk4oe6khZT25r1j
transaction
ed3ddda223ea8db186b110ce724c3112489b74cf13f394048418f4c182eeb83a